DevOps Game
Simulate DevOps collaboration to enhance communication and efficiency.
The DevOps Game is a serious game that immerses participants in scenarios of collaboration between development and operations. Inspired by the NUMMI experience, this game helps teams overcome the challenges of continuous integration and delivery. Participants learn to improve their communication and optimise their processes while having fun in a playful setting.
Walkthrough
- 1
Introduction and Objectives
10 minThe facilitator presents the context of the game, briefly explaining the NUMMI experience and its connection to DevOps. They clarify that the aim is to simulate real-life collaboration situations between development and operations teams. Participants are invited to familiarise themselves with the game's objectives: to improve communication, collaboration, and efficiency.
Tip — Use anecdotes from the NUMMI experience to illustrate the importance of collaboration.
- 2
Team Formation
10 minDivide participants into two groups: developers and operators. Each group receives a role sheet describing their responsibilities and specific objectives. The facilitator explains that each team must work together to deliver a quality product while overcoming communication and process obstacles.
Tip — Ensure that each participant fully understands their role and objectives to promote complete immersion.
- 3
Scenario Simulation
20 minTeams face several scenarios simulating common challenges in DevOps, such as critical bugs or tight deadlines. Each team must propose solutions within a limited time, effectively communicating with the other group. The facilitator observes and notes interactions, intervening if necessary to guide discussions.
Tip — Encourage teams to document their processes and share their ideas to enrich the experience.
- 4
Solution Evaluation
15 minEach team presents its solutions to the encountered scenarios, explaining their approach and expected outcomes. The facilitator leads a feedback session where teams evaluate each other on the relevance of the proposed solutions and the quality of communication.
Tip — Promote constructive feedback by asking open-ended questions and valuing each team's efforts.
- 5
Summary and Learnings
10 minThe facilitator summarises the key points of the workshop, highlighting observed best practices and areas for improvement. They connect the learnings from the game to the NUMMI experience, emphasising the importance of a culture of continuous collaboration and communication.
Tip — Use concrete examples from the scenarios to illustrate the learnings and reinforce their impact.
Variants
- Add a mediator role to help resolve conflicts between teams.
- Integrate unexpected events into the scenarios to test teams' responsiveness.
- Use digital tools to simulate a remote working environment.
Debrief guide
- What were the main challenges encountered during the simulation?
- How did communication influence your team's results?
- Which solutions were the most effective and why?
- How could you apply these learnings in your professional context?
- How does the NUMMI experience inspire you to improve your own company culture?
- What changes would you propose to enhance collaboration between your teams?
- How has the game changed your perception of DevOps collaboration?
